Type locality: Switzerland . Material examined Lectotype (here designated) [ SWITZERLAND ] • 1 ♂ ; NHMW-HYM#0005388 . Paralectotype [ SWITZERLAND ] • 1 ♂ ; NHMW-HYM#0006893 . Remarks The lectotype is card-mounted, with the wing and antenna disarticulated and slide-mounted. Huggert labeled this lectotype but the designation was never published.
